All of the talking about front mounting of oil coolers has me thinking....
Has anyone removed the stock oil cooler and used the mounting holes to hold a plate with an fittings? You could then ues the stock location as a take off to 2 hoses that can be then run to the front of the car. Am I crazy???? I have a lathe and mill so fabrication is no problem....thanks, herb thinking about an-10 or an-12 for sizes..... |

Yep, I removed the stock cooler on my -4 and added the plate with the fittings. My cooler is mounted in my rear spoiler.
